Re: GPG errors from apt update



That key is in debian-keyring, but was not in apt.

I had to manually add the /usr/share/keyrings/debian-keyring.* keyrings to ~root/.gnupg/gpg.conf, then extract the keys and add with apt-key.

Shouldn't this be automatic?

But it does not matter.  I still get the same error on `apt-get update`:

W: GPG error: http://security.debian.org stable/updates Release: The following signatures were invalid: BADSIG 010908312D230C5F Debian Archive Automatic Signing Key (2006) <ftpmaster@debian.org> W: GPG error: http://security.debian.org testing/updates Release: The following signatures were invalid: BADSIG 010908312D230C5F Debian Archive Automatic Signing Key (2006) <ftpmaster@debian.org>

Robert Dobbs wrote:

W: GPG error: http://security.debian.org stable/updates Release: The following signatures were invalid: BADSIG 010908312D230C5F Debian

have you update that key before?

# gpg --keyserver pgp.mit.edu --recv-keys 010908312D230C5F
# gpg --armor --export 010908312D230C5F | apt-key add -
